Ted Knight leads bands playing music that people of all ages can enjoy. There's pop, rock, reggae, jazz, blues, and Latin, from a duo to a twenty-piece big band.
Knight Music is right for parties, weddings, dances, concerts and corporate events. Based in South Florida, they've played in Tampa and Jacksonville as well as Miami and Boca Raton, and they're available to play anywhere in the Southeast.
Ted sings from his keyboard, with additional vocalists available. He uses real drums and horns instead of recorded backgrounds, getting the groove that only true live music can create.
Crosswind features guitar and keyboard, playing artists like Santana, Creedence, the Eagles, Bob Marley and Jimmy Buffet.
The World's Smallest Big Band has two horns, the orchestra has four, and Ted's big band has ten horns or more.
The mix starts with jazz, swing and blues, adding pop, rock and Latin as needed.
Knight Music combos start with TK Express, a keyboard and drums duo. Add bass, sax or guitar for a trio, or two out of three for a quartet. The quintet with sax and trumpet has released a CD of jazz standards, Beautiful Love.
Specialty bands
The Dixie Ramblers play Dixieland jazz and swing. Orquesta Nostalgia is a Latin band that can play American pop and rock when needed. Ted also has bands playing music for Christmas, St. Patrick's Day, and Oktoberfest.
